Recent Sale Spotlight: 3200 Block of Moreno Avenue

On September 22, 2025, a 2,131-square-foot home located in the 3200⁤ block of Moreno Avenue, San Jose, sold for ‍$1,300,000. This translates to approximately $610 per square foot.The property, built in 1991, features ⁣five bedrooms, three bathrooms, and two parking spaces, situated on a 4,750-square-foot lot. This ​sale provides a valuable data point for assessing current market values in this specific neighborhood.

Comparative Market Analysis: Nearby Sales

To gain a more extensive ⁣understanding ⁢of​ the San Jose ⁢market,let’s examine several comparable ⁣sales in the vicinity. Analyzing these transactions helps establish a range of values⁢ for similar properties:

* Vernice ⁤Avenue, San Jose (December 2024): A 1,209-square-foot home ‍sold for $1,009,500⁣ ($835/sq ft) with 3 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ms. This represents a lower price per square foot, likely ‍due‍ to the smaller size of the property.
*​ Arthur ⁣Avenue, San Jose (June 2024): A 1,314-square-foot home sold for $1,214,000 ($924/sq ft) featuring 4 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ms. This sale demonstrates a higher price per square foot​ than the Vernice Avenue transaction, possibly reflecting upgrades or⁢ a ⁤more desirable location.
* ​ Vernice Avenue, san Jose⁤ (March 2025): Another 1,209-square-foot home on Vernice Avenue‍ sold for $1,120,000 ($926/sq ft) with 3 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ms. ⁤This sale further ⁣reinforces the trend of higher prices per square foot in this area.
